Transaction 324aaa42149180a4970312af26a9fe770a02b2fba544040ac970dea60ca1f1da
1 Input
1 Output
-
324aaa42149180a4970312af26a9fe770a02b2fba544040ac970dea60ca1f1da:0
- value
- 50882
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e9d6e60bb6dff95c32e206f949473b60ff7c8be
- address
- bc1qp6wkuc9mdhletsewyphef9rnkc8l0j975z8srf